Neoantigen-specific immunity in low mutation burden colorectal cancers of the consensus molecular subtype 4

Background The efficacy of checkpoint blockade immunotherapies in colorectal cancer is currently restricted to a minority of patients diagnosed with mismatch repair-deficient tumors having high mutation burden.
